PROGRAM COSTS AND STATISTICS
MASTERS
Information provided below represents CIP (Classification of Instructional Program) Programmatic data from students that have graduated between 7/1/11 & 6/30/12:
# of Semesters for Normal Completion Time Frame of Program 6
Average # of Semesters to Completion** ****
% of Students Completing in Normal Time Frame: ****
 
Program Costs per Semester:
Tuition $6,350
Room & Board*** $2,191
Estimated Books & Fees $500
Ave. Median Loan Debt (Federal/Private/Institution) of Program Completers*: ****
 
Information provided below represents Institutional data from attending UAT students between 7/1/11 & 6/30/12:
% of Students Receiving Financial Aid (FA) during 12 month period** 83%
Average % of Tuition Covered by FA during 12 month period** 100%
Average Amount of Scholarship/Grant Awards Received during 12 month period** $7,126
 
*Median Loan Debt is calculated using the debt that students incurred during their duration at the University.
**Item not required disclosures but included for potential enhancement to information.
***Rate is that of a shared room and bath per semester based upon a 12-month lease.
****Median Loan Debt and On Time completion percentage not posted based on Department of Education guidance with respect to small programs.
